FAQ's of Double Action Air Valve:


Q: How is the Double Action Air Valve installed in pneumatic systems?

A: The valve features an inline, threaded connection (BSP male-female), simplifying installation in most pneumatic setups. Its cylindrical, rigid body enables quick mounting in both new and existing lines.

Q: What makes this air valve suitable for industrial automation applications?

A: Its high cycle life, robust brass construction, and precise tolerance make it ideal for demanding industrial automation, ensuring minimal leakage and reliable operation in high-pressure environments.

Q: When should I replace the Double Action Air Valve?

A: Given its formidable durability of over 1 million cycles, replacement is seldom required. Consider replacing only after extended service or if cycle life has been reached to ensure optimal system performance.

Q: Where is this air valve typically used in industrial plants?

A: The valve is widely employed in various plant automation applications, such as controlling pneumatic actuators, automated machinery, and assembly lines across multiple sectors.

Q: What are the main benefits of the O-Ring sealing type in this valve?

A: The O-Ring seal provides superior leak prevention, even under high-pressure (up to 10 bar), thereby prolonging equipment lifespan and ensuring operational safety in critical systems.
